7.14 Constant Speed Propeller
(Not for LSA certified in USA)
If your REMOS GX is equipped with a constant speed propeller the
rate of climb increases and a lower fuel consumption in cruise flight
is realized. According to Rotax maintenance handbook it is
permissible to operating the engine between full power and propeller
curve without restrictions. The operation above 5.500 rpm is limited
on 5 minutes. The maximum permissible engine speed is 5.800 rpm.
For economic reasons the following combination of manifold
pressure and engine speed is recommended.
Power Setting
Engine Speed
[ rpm ]
Manifold Pressure
[ in Hg ]
Take off 5.800 full throttle
max. cont. power 5.500 full throttle
75% 5.000 26
65% 4.800 26
55% 4.300 24
The propeller is electrically adjusted and needs a few seconds to
change the total pitch range. Changes in power setting should be
performed slowly to avoid overspeeding.
